Photochemical Structural Transformation of a Linear 1D Coordination Polymer Impacts the Electrical Conductivity

A pair of 4-(1-naphthylvinyl)pyridine (4-nvp) ligands has been successfully aligned in head-to-tail fashion in a one-dimensional (1D) double chain ladder polymer [Cd(adc)(4-nvp)<sub>2</sub>(H<sub>2</sub>O)] <sub>n</sub> (1; H<sub>2</sub>adc = acetylenedicarboxylic acid) that undergoes a photochemical [2 + 2] cycloaddition reaction accompanied by single-crystal to single-crystal (SCSC) structural transformation from a 1D chain to a 2D layer structure. These structural changes have a significant impact on the conductivity and Schottky nature of the compound.
